This is happening due to the deliberate inaction by the government departments which does anything other than help the consumer. 1. Information: The government can transparently put the import cost of medical devices on its website for imported goods and the excise information for local goods . This will help the customers know input costs. Provide certain guidelines or a code of conduct for the medical community. 2. Survey: Randomly collect billing information to ascertain the level of margin. 3. Prosecution: Need to provide more financial support & infrastructure to the Consumer Fora for speedier justice. The Department of Consumer Affairs should enhance the level of support to the Fora. more
